Technical Advisory

Designing Robust Multi-Agent Teams for Complex Workflows

Production-grade multi-agent orchestration: patterns, state management, observability, and governance to deliver reliable, scalable AI-driven workflows.

Suhas BhairavPublished May 2, 2026 · Updated May 8, 2026 · 9 min read

Multi-Agent Orchestration is not a theoretical abstraction. It is a production-grade approach to building teams of specialized agents that operate across a distributed tech stack with explicit interfaces, deterministic state, and principled governance. When designed as an ecosystem rather than a collection of glue scripts, agent teams deliver faster deployment, safer experimentation, and measurable business value at scale.

Viewed through an architectural lens, agent teams are the operating system for modern workflows. By establishing contract-first interfaces, versioned state, and observable decision logs, you enable concurrent execution, robust rollback, and evolvable governance. This article distills practical patterns, failure modes, and a concrete modernization path you can apply to real-world data pipelines, microservices, and AI-enabled services.

Why This Problem Matters

Enterprise platforms increasingly rely on coordinated actions across services, data stores, and AI components. No single component holds every capability or piece of knowledge; instead, purposeful agent teams collaborate to execute end-to-end workflows such as autonomous data processing, real-time decisioning, and customer journeys. The stakes are governance, safety, and reproducibility in production, not hype.

Key realities drive this need: distributed autonomy must be orchestrated with explicit contracts and strong observability; probabilistic AI behavior requires deterministic state machines and robust rollback; and modernization must be incremental, safe, and measurable. Governance, security, and compliance demand auditable data flows and policy-aware routing. A well-designed agent platform yields reduced cycle time, improved resilience, and safer experimentation with AI-driven automation at scale. This connects closely with Autonomous Customer Success: Agents Providing 24/7 Technical Support for Custom Parts.

Technical Patterns, Trade-offs, and Failure Modes

Understanding orchestration patterns helps teams pick approaches aligned with domain needs. The patterns below come with clear trade-offs and failure modes you should anticipate. A related implementation angle appears in Autonomous Multi-Lingual Site Support: Translating Technical Specs in Real-Time.

Patterns

  • Centralized Orchestrator with Agent Extensions: A core coordinating component issues workflow directives to specialized agents. Pros include strong global visibility; cons include potential bottlenecks and single points of failure if not designed with redundancy.
  • Federated Agent Teams with Lightweight Coordination: Each agent operates autonomously, coordinating via shared events and contracts. Pros include resilience and scalability; cons include complexity in ensuring global correctness.
  • Event-Driven Workflow with Stateful Choreography: Agents react to events on an event bus, using versioned contracts. Pros include loose coupling and high throughput; cons include eventual consistency and debugging challenges.
  • DAG-Based Workflow Engines with Actor-Focused Extensions: Workflows are expressed as graphs, with agents mapped to nodes. Pros include clear dependencies; cons include rigidity unless extended for dynamic tasks.
  • Policy-Driven Orchestration: A policy layer drives routing, failure handling, and data access. Pros include clarity and control; cons include policy sprawl if not modular.
  • Hybrid Architectures: Central coordination for guarantees with decentralized execution. Pros balance global control and local autonomy; cons require careful boundary design and integration tests.

Trade-offs

  • Latency vs Throughput: Centralized control offers guarantees but can add latency; decentralized models scale but require sophisticated consistency mechanisms.
  • Consistency vs Availability: Strong consistency simplifies reasoning but may limit speed; eventual consistency enables speed but demands robust reconciliation.
  • Simplicity vs Flexibility: Simple pipelines are easy to reason about; flexible agent designs support evolution but raise governance complexity.
  • Coupling vs Autonomy: Tight coupling eases coordination but reduces resilience; autonomy requires contracts and versioning to avoid drift.
  • Observability Burden: Rich tracing aids debugging but adds instrumentation cost; design for selective, meaningful observability.
  • Security and Compliance: Centralized control strengthens governance but may enlarge attack surfaces; distributed control requires robust policy enforcement.

Failure Modes

  • Deadlock and Livelock: Circular dependencies or retry storms; mitigate with timeouts and backoffs.
  • Partial Failures and Data Inconsistency: Partial updates; address with idempotent operations and compensating actions.
  • Message Loss or Duplication: Network issues; aim for exactly-once processing where feasible and idempotent handlers.
  • Drift and Schema Mismatch: Conflicting data shapes; enforce schema evolution policies and compatibility checks.
  • Policy Violations: Overstepping permissions; implement policy enforcement points and auditable logs.
  • Resource Contention: Compute or I/O bottlenecks; apply backpressure and quotas to preserve critical paths.
  • Observability Gaps: Incomplete tracing; invest in end-to-end visibility and correlation IDs.

State Management and Consistency

State is the backbone of agent collaboration. Use explicit ownership, versioned schemas, and immutable histories. Prefer finite state machines embedded in task definitions to provide deterministic progress and rollback semantics. Ensure workflows can be replayed or compensated, and maintain a durable ledger of decisions for auditing and reconciliation, even if some agents are unavailable. In distributed systems, favor idempotent operations and explicit compensation to avoid drift on replays. The same architectural pressure shows up in Autonomous Tier-1 Resolution: Deploying Goal-Driven Multi-Agent Systems.

Observability, Testing, and Reliability

Observability should cover tracing, throughput and latency metrics, and state provenance for audits. Instrument agents with deterministic IDs, start-stop timestamps, input-output deltas, and policy decisions. Testing should span unit tests for individual agents, contract tests for interfaces, integration tests for workflow graphs, and chaos testing to reveal brittleness. Reliability practices—SLOs, error budgets, runbooks, and staged rollouts—are essential for safe modernization and expansion of agent teams.

Practical Implementation Considerations

With patterns in view, these concrete steps help teams implement robust multi-agent orchestration in production. Focus on practical, incremental changes that preserve safety and governance while delivering measurable improvements.

Interface and Contract Design

  • Define explicit agent interfaces: inputs, outputs, preconditions, and postconditions for every task. Contract-first design ensures compatibility across agents.
  • Adopt versioned data contracts and workflow definitions: separate evolution of agent behavior from runtime state.
  • Model data schemas clearly: use evolvable schemas with backward-compatible rules to minimize drift between agents.
  • Implement idempotent task handlers: design agents to be safely retriable or to record and replay decisions deterministically.
  • Provide clear failure handling contracts: specify retry rules, escalation, and compensation triggers.

State, Orchestration, and Data Flows

  • Choose an orchestration paradigm aligned with domain needs: centralized guarantees for mission-critical workflows or decentralized event-driven coordination for high-velocity tasks.
  • Represent workflows as explicit state machines or DAGs: ensure transitions are deterministic and provide tooling to visualize progress and dependencies.
  • Separate orchestration state from business data: store workflow state independently to enable replay and rollback without affecting domain data.
  • Use immutable event logs as truth: maintain complete histories of decisions, inputs, outputs, and applied policies.

Observability, Testing, and Safety

  • Instrument end-to-end tracing: propagate correlation IDs across agents and services for root-cause analysis.
  • Monitor health and latency budgets: set SLOs for key workflows and alert on deviations that signal systemic risk.
  • Adopt robust testing: unit, integration, contract, and end-to-end tests; include synthetic workloads and failure injections.
  • Develop runbooks and playbooks: document standard operating procedures for common failures and recovery steps.

Security, Privacy, and Compliance

  • Enforce least-privilege access for agents: use granular IAM policies and attribute-based access controls.
  • Implement data lineage and governance: track provenance, transformations, and agent decisions for auditing.
  • Protect data in transit and at rest: apply encryption and secure channels between agents and services.
  • Audit and anomaly detection: monitor for policy violations and unusual agent behavior.

Operational Readiness and Modernization Strategy

  • Adopt incremental modernization: start with a target workflow, prove safety and value, then extend to other domains.
  • Define a platform team mandate: build reusable agent libraries, contracts, and tooling for rapid experimentation by product teams.
  • Invest in tooling for workflow design and testing: visual editors, simulators, and dry-run capabilities to validate changes pre-deployment.
  • Plan evolution: implement versioned upgrade paths for agents and contracts with clear compatibility guarantees and rollback options.
  • Balance centralized governance with decentralized execution: set center-out policies while preserving agent autonomy where appropriate.

Tooling and Technology Considerations

  • Workflow engines and orchestration runtimes: choose substrates that support state machines, DAGs, and event-driven patterns with durability guarantees.
  • Messaging and event buses: select reliable transports with appropriate at-least-once or exactly-once semantics.
  • Observability stack: distributed tracing, metrics, and dashboards accessible to operators and developers.
  • Data stores and state stores: align storage with workload needs—fast mutable state for active workflows and durable stores for provenance.
  • Security tooling: integrate identity management, access controls, encryption, and audit logging from the outset.

Strategic Perspective

Beyond immediate technical decisions, senior teams should embed a strategic view to ensure long-term viability, adaptability, and business impact of multi-agent orchestration. The following dimensions shape a durable, scalable approach.

Platform Strategy and Architectures

Adopt a platform-centric view that treats agent teams as a core capability. Standardize interfaces, contracts, and workflow representations for reuse across domains. Build a lightweight, modular orchestration substrate that evolves with AI advances, data platform changes, and policy requirements. Favor decoupled components with clear boundaries to enable independent upgrades and risk containment during modernization.

Governance, Risk Management, and Compliance

Governance must scale with the organization as agent teams proliferate. Define declarative policy-as-code for routing, data access, and compensation rules, versioned and tested. Establish risk budgets and escalation paths to keep experimentation within approved bounds. Regularly review dependencies and vendor risk as part of technical due diligence.

Talent, Collaboration, and Developer Experience

Invest in developer experience: clear onboarding for agent libraries and contracts, comprehensive runbooks, and shared tooling for testing, tracing, and debugging. Foster collaboration between AI researchers, platform engineers, and product teams to align agent capabilities with business outcomes. Treat experimentation as a structured discipline with safety rails and measurable outcomes.

Roadmap and Metrics

Define a staged modernization plan with concrete milestones and risk controls. Track metrics that reflect engineering and business impact, such as cycle time reduction, mean time to recovery, agent reliability, data quality, and policy-compliance rates. Use these metrics to balance centralized guarantees with decentralized autonomy as the platform evolves.

Future-Proofing and AI Alignment

As AI capabilities evolve, expect growing use of collaborative AI systems, learning-enabled agents, and adaptive policies. Plan for alignment, safety, and explainability of decisions. Design the platform to accommodate new agent types and interaction models without destabilizing existing workflows.

Conclusion

Designing and operating teams of agents to orchestrate complex workflows is a mature discipline that blends applied AI, distributed systems, and disciplined modernization. Reliability comes from explicit interfaces, robust state management, strong observability, and principled governance, not hype. With these foundations, agent-based automation can scale safely across production environments, delivering measurable business value while maintaining safety and accountability.

FAQ

What is multi-agent orchestration?

Multi-agent orchestration is a platform approach that coordinates autonomous agents with explicit interfaces, state machines, and governance to execute complex workflows across distributed systems.

How do you design agent interfaces and contracts?

Start with contract-first design: define inputs, outputs, preconditions, and postconditions for each task, and version contracts alongside workflow definitions.

What patterns work well for agent coordination?

Patterns like centralized orchestration with extensions, federated autonomous agents, event-driven choreography, DAG-based workflows, policy-driven routing, and hybrid architectures each offer trade-offs in visibility, latency, and resilience.

How is observability handled in multi-agent systems?

End-to-end tracing, correlated IDs, and state provenance are essential. Instrument agents with deterministic IDs, timestamps, and policy logs to enable root-cause analysis and audits.

How do you ensure security and compliance?

Enforce least-privilege access, track data lineage, encrypt data in transit and at rest, and implement auditable decision logs with anomaly detection.

What is the ROI of multi-agent orchestration?

Expect faster cycle times, safer experimentation, fewer production incidents, and improved data governance as you scale agent-enabled workflows across domains.

How should modernization be planned?

Adopt an incremental strategy starting with a high-value workflow, establish reusable libraries and tooling, and build a versioned upgrade path with rollback options to minimize risk.

About the author

Suhas Bhairav is a systems architect and applied AI researcher focused on production-grade AI systems, distributed architecture, knowledge graphs, RAG, AI agents, and enterprise AI implementation. Learn more at Suhas Bhairav.